The National Road Map Strategic Plan to Improve Reproductive, Maternal, Newborn, Child & Adolescent Health in Tanzania (2016 - 2020) One Plan II

Ministry of Health, Tanzania

This strategic plan guides the implementation of RMNCAH interventions in the country, building on the progress made under One Plan (2008-2015). The strategy focuses on reducing maternal, new-born, child and adolescent morbidity and mortality by offering quality services, of equity, offered by skilled attendants, in enabling environment and in an integrated manner along the continuum of care by taking into consideration both community and facility factors.

Poverty and Human Development Report 2005

Ministry of Finance and Economic Cooperation, Tanzania

This Poverty and Human Development Report 2005 is the third in a series produced by the Research and Analysis Working Group of the Government of Tanzania’s Poverty Monitoring System. This monitoring system aims to provide timely, reliable information about poverty levels and trends and the results of analyses of data concerning poverty in Tanzania. This is the first report of the Research and Analysis Working Group since the start of the new National Strategy for Growth and Reduction of Poverty (NSGRP), which translates into “Mkakati wa Kukuza Uchumi na Kupunguza Umasikini Tanzania (MKUKUTA)”.

Secondary Education Development Plan (SEDP) 2004 – 2009

Ministry of Education, Tanzania

This Plan outlines the framework for achieving greater access to secondary education while simultaneously tackling equity, retention, quality and management issues. Secondary Education Development Plan also addresses the Government’s policy on decentralization of the management of the delivery of social services, including education and focuses also on capacity building for the central government to improve the execution of its core functions of policy formulation, provision of a responsive regulatory framework, quality assurance, and improved monitoring and evaluation.
